Portugal needs win over Uzbekistan as Ronaldo criticism intensifies

Portugal opened the 2026 World Cup with a 1‑1 draw against the Democratic Republic of Congo, sparking fierce criticism of veteran striker Cristiano Ronaldo after a goalless, ineffective performance. Several Portuguese players defended the veteran: full‑back João Cancelo said Ronaldo and Brazil’s Neymar “don’t need to prove anything to anyone,” while Diogo Dalot and forward Francisco Conceição stressed that the team is not obliged to always feed Ronaldo. Former Manchester United midfielder Paul Scholes, speaking on a podcast, suggested that at 41 Ronaldo should only start as a goalkeeper. Coach Roberto Martínez has evaded questions about Ronaldo’s starting role, citing internal discussions and the need for unity amid “noise” from the media. The squad faces a must‑win second‑group game against Uzbekistan on 23 June in Houston to stay in contention for the knockout stage, with the win essential to avoid falling behind group leaders Colombia.
